#c60320 hex color
In a RGB color space, hex #c60320 is composed of 77.6% red, 1.2% green and 12.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 98.5% magenta, 83.8% yellow and 22.4% black. It has a hue angle of 351.1 degrees, a saturation of 97% and a lightness of 39.4%. #c60320 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ff0640 with #8d0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0033.

● #c60320 color description : Strong red.
The hexadecimal color #c60320 has RGB values of R:198, G:3, B:32 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.98, Y:0.84, K:0.22. Its decimal value is 12976928.

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050001 is the darkest color, while #fff0f3 is the lightest one.
